En la misma l\u00ednea que el relleno de gas, los espaciadores de vidrio desempe\u00f1an un papel importante en el rendimiento t\u00e9rmico de una unidad de vidrio aislante. Por lo tanto, es imperativo asegurarse de que su tecnolog\u00eda espaciadora sea eficaz y sostenible.<\/p>\n<p>En una unidad de vidrio aislante, los espaciadores determinan la anchura del espacio entre dos o m\u00e1s piezas de vidrio. La funci\u00f3n principal de los espaciadores es proporcionar un espacio fijo entre las capas de vidrio.<\/p>\n<p>A lo largo de los a\u00f1os, el sector del vidrio ha visto multitud de progresos y cambios en cuanto a los materiales y las tecnolog\u00edas utilizados para fabricar espaciadores de vidrio aislante. Debido a que los espaciadores definen la cantidad de calor y fr\u00edo que puede pasar a trav\u00e9s de los paneles de vidrio, la tecnolog\u00eda de los espaciadores es uno de los principales factores que garantizan el rendimiento del vidrio.<\/p>\n<blockquote><p>Actualmente, en que hay una demanda elevada de materiales de construcci\u00f3n m\u00e1s ecol\u00f3gicos, cada vez se presta m\u00e1s atenci\u00f3n al hecho de que los separadores de vidrio sean capaces de aumentar la eficiencia energ\u00e9tica del vidrio aislante.<\/p><\/blockquote>\n<h2><strong>Amplia variedad de opciones de espaciadores<\/strong><\/h2>\n<p>Los espaciadores de vidrio aislante est\u00e1n disponibles en diferentes materiales, colores y toda una variedad de grosores. Para una unidad de vidrio aislante, los tres aspectos son esenciales y afectan al rendimiento. Por ejemplo, incluso un peque\u00f1o cambio en el grosor del espaciador afecta a sus caracter\u00edsticas de conductividad. Entretanto, el material determina la cantidad de calor y fr\u00edo que puede pasar a trav\u00e9s del vidrio&nbsp;y, por consiguiente, desempe\u00f1a un papel importante en la eficiencia energ\u00e9tica de la unidad.<\/p>\n<p>En cuanto al material, los espaciadores suelen dividirse en dos grupos principales: espaciadores de aluminio o de borde caliente.<\/p>\n<p><img decoding=\"async\" loading=\"lazy\" class=\"alignnone wp-image-12476 lazyload\" src=\"data:image\/gif;base64,R0lGODlhAQABAAAAACH5BAEKAAEALAAAAAABAAEAAAICTAEAOw==\" data-src=\"https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1.jpg\" alt=\"Insulating glass spacers\" width=\"597\" height=\"310\" data-sizes=\"auto\" data-srcset=\"https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1.jpg 1009w, https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1-300x156.jpg 300w, https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1-768x399.jpg 768w, https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1-640x332.jpg 640w\" sizes=\"(max-width: 597px) 100vw, 597px\" \/><noscript><img decoding=\"async\" loading=\"lazy\" class=\"alignnone wp-image-12476\" src=\"https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1.jpg\" alt=\"Insulating glass spacers\" width=\"597\" height=\"310\" srcset=\"https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1.jpg 1009w, https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1-300x156.jpg 300w, https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1-768x399.jpg 768w, https:\/\/www.glastory.net\/wp-content\/uploads\/2020\/06\/spacerbender_MULTI_ENGLISH1-640x332.jpg 640w\" sizes=\"(max-width: 597px) 100vw, 597px\" \/><\/noscript><\/p>\n<h4><strong>Espaciadores de aluminio<\/strong><\/h4>\n<p>Originalmente, los espaciadores de aluminio eran el tipo de espaciadores m\u00e1s utilizado. Este material est\u00e1 disponible desde hace d\u00e9cadas y proporciona el nivel de rendimiento b\u00e1sico.<\/p>\n<blockquote><p>Aunque es un material estructuralmente fuerte, el aluminio es un conductor t\u00e9rmico muy eficiente. Eso significa que los espaciadores de aluminio facilitan la p\u00e9rdida de calor del interior al exterior. Adem\u00e1s, los bordes de vidrio fr\u00edo causados por el aluminio crean una diferencia de temperatura entre el centro del vidrio y sus bordes. Por lo tanto, las unidades de vidrio aislante son propensas a la condensaci\u00f3n.<\/p><\/blockquote>\n<h4><strong>Espaciadores de borde caliente<\/strong><\/h4>\n<p>Los crecientes requisitos energ\u00e9ticos, no obstante, han creado demanda de soluciones m\u00e1s nuevas. Es por ello que se introdujeron los espaciadores de borde caliente hechos de materiales de baja conductividad como alternativa de mayor rendimiento a los espaciadores de aluminio tradicionales.<\/p>\n<blockquote><p>La tecnolog\u00eda de borde caliente ha cambiado radicalmente el mercado de las ventanas. No solo ayuda a prevenir la p\u00e9rdida de calor a trav\u00e9s de las ventanas y a mejorar la eficiencia energ\u00e9tica de la unidad, sino que tambi\u00e9n reduce el problema de la condensaci\u00f3n.<\/p><\/blockquote>\n<p>Actualmente, hay disponibles una amplia variedad de dise\u00f1os de espaciadores de borde caliente. Cada uno elimina el efecto de la p\u00e9rdida de calor hasta cierto punto, a la vez que ofrece diferentes niveles de integridad estructural.<\/p>\n<p><strong><em>Espaciadores de borde caliente de acero inoxidable<\/em><\/strong><\/p>\n<p>Los materiales de acero inoxidable, junto con sus propiedades, son similares a los de los espaciadores de aluminio. Sin embargo, el acero inoxidable tiene solo una d\u00e9cima parte de la conductividad t\u00e9rmica del aluminio y mejora la resistencia a la condensaci\u00f3n.<\/p>\n<p>A\u00fan as\u00ed, los espaciadores de acero inoxidable son much\u00edsimo m\u00e1s conductores que otras opciones de espaciadores de borde caliente<\/p>\n<p><strong><em>Espaciadores de borde caliente h\u00edbridos de pl\u00e1stico-metal<\/em><\/strong><\/p>\n<p>Este tipo de espaciadores de borde caliente habitualmente se fabrican de materiales pl\u00e1sticos, como policarbonatos, polipropileno y otros, combinados con cu\u00f1as bajas de metal.&nbsp;<\/p>\n<p><strong><em>Espaciadores flexibles de borde caliente<\/em><\/strong><\/p>\n<p>Los espaciadores flexibles se han desarrollado utilizando materiales termopl\u00e1sticos o a base de silicona flexibles y maleables, con tamices moleculares incorporados.<\/p>\n<p>Entre estos, el tipo de espaciadores de butilo termofusible sin aditivos es el que m\u00e1s destaca.
